    Map Description

    Well is a symmetrical Territory map with a 60 second set up time where teams can capture their first 2 points and group up at the gates before charging in to meet the enemy team head on in an epic battle over the middle territory and access to the Flame Thrower. Teams spawn in the armory rooms. while in the room they are safe from enemy attacks and only one way out, no way in. In the room players can choose they're "Class" by picking up the different weapons put out in the room. This is meant to recreate choosing their class in Team Fortress.

    However, the Engineer could not be portrayed in Halo 3 because of the lack of the "building" ability outside of forge. The Pyro class can only be used if the team has access to the middle point by picking up the flame thrower, while the Custom Power up on the map helps portray the spy's abilities by giving the user a good camo, but reducing their damage output to 0 and resistance to 10%, making kills only viable through assassinations. The rest of the classes are represented to weapons found in the spawn room and/or through the equipment in the rooms (such as the Brute Shot and Trip Mine for the Demoman).

    The First/Last Point teams will capture or defend. Defenders have a hight advantage, but attackers can look at their setup through the energy door.

    The Second/Forth Point has a lot of tight areas and defenders have access to the rafters through their First Point. The Defenders must make their way through a tight corridor to get access to the point, which should be easy with the Flame Thrower they picked up from the Middle Point. Defenders can also get access to the rafters through the middle point to flank enemy positions and to take the height advantages.

    The Middle Point is blocked off for the first minute of the round. Once open it reveals the enemy teams to each other and a blood bath ensues. Proper use of the Regenerators is essential to survival, so is using the Sniper Rifle to take the enemy teams Regenerator out. With all the distractions, players who are cloaked can take advantage of the chaos and try to sneak behind the enemy team and take out the heavy hitters.

    Version History:

    V1 aka: Granary-- basic set up was established.

    V1.5-- set up was tweaked with the addition of set up doors.

    V1.7-- Spawn room was finalized with weapons and equipment and a teleporter exit system that is disguised as a door.

    V1.9-- The map was redone with more cleaner looking interlocking and look.

    V2 aka Well-- final map finished with the addition of "trains" to give it more of a Well feel from the original game. (thanks to albino dave for giving me the idea)
